    >>Would the CLI one work if my GUI MTA and client is Mozilla mail?
    >
    > No, it works like this (one of the ways, at least):
    >
    > You configure fetchmail to download your mail. Fetchmail passes it on
    > to postfix (or sendmail, depending on what you installed). Then
    > procmail delivers it to your /var/spool/mail/user or ~/Maildir/
    > depending on how you configure it. You mail program picks it up there.
    >
    > I think (might be wrong, haven't used mozilla for mail in a while) that
    > mozilla can't pick up local mail, so you might have to configure a pop
    > server for that.
